In the given figure, AB is diameter of the circle and points C and D are on the circumference such that ∠CAD = 30° and ∠CBA = 70°. What is the measure of ∠ACD?

Answer & solution

Correct answer: 40°

Solution

If we draw the imaginary lines AC and BD, we find that
∠ CAD and CBD are subtended by the same chord DC.
∴ CAD = CBD = 30°.
Thus, DBA = (70 – 30) = 40°.
Also, DBA and ACD are subtended by the same chord DA.
Hence, ACD = DBA = 40°.
